Kearney Consumer Industries & Retail Principal

Remote, USA Full-time Posted 2026-06-13

Job Description

As a Principal within Kearney’s Consumer Industries & Retail Practice (CIRP), you will play a critical leadership role in building and scaling our Fashion & Luxury sector. This is a high-visibility position for a seasoned leader with deep apparel and merchandising expertise who can engage clients at the executive level, lead complex engagements end to end, and help shape the future of a fast-growing practice. You will work closely with senior client stakeholders and internal leadership to develop insights, drive impact, and grow long-term client relationships across the fashion, apparel, footwear, and adjacent beauty ecosystem. What You’ll Do Client Leadership & Delivery

  • Lead large, high-impact Fashion & Luxury engagements from problem definition through analysis, synthesis, and executive-level client communication
  • Serve as a trusted advisor to C-suite and senior merchandising, planning, and brand leaders at leading apparel and retail organizations
  • Drive work across corporate and growth strategy, merchandising and assortment strategy, apparel planning, go-to-market strategy, and enterprise transformation
  • Lead cross-functional teams and manage multiple complex workstreams with autonomy and accountability

Industry & Functional Expertise

  • Bring deep content expertise in apparel and fashion, with a strong command of core business functions including:
  • Merchandising and assortment strategy
  • Apparel and demand planning
  • Product development, sourcing, and design (preferred)
  • Brand, franchise, and portfolio strategy
  • Apply this expertise across vertically integrated apparel brands, multi-brand retailers, and luxury players
  • Contribute thought leadership on industry trends and emerging topics across fashion, apparel, and beauty

Business Development & Practice Growth

  • Originate and expand client relationships, with a clear ability to drive revenue growth within existing and new accounts
  • Lead proposal development, participate in senior-level client pitches, and shape commercial strategy
  • Support the continued growth and differentiation of Kearney’s Fashion & Luxury offering within CIRP
  • Mentor and develop junior team members while helping build a strong, collaborative sector community

Who You Are After nearly 100 years, we know this business is fundamentally about making connections—between facts, figures, insights, strategies, tools, technologies, and above all, people. That’s why we look for collaborative, insightful, and inquisitive problem-solvers who don’t accept the first thing in front of them and who are always unapologetically themselves. We Want To Hear From You If You Have

  • An MBA (preferred) and 10+ years of professional experience
  • Significant Principal-level experience in top-tier management consulting, with demonstrated market traction
  • Deep Fashion & Apparel expertise, particularly across merchandising, apparel planning, and core product commercialization functions
  • Experience working with leading apparel, footwear, retail, and/or luxury brands
  • A strong client network and the ability to engage senior executives as a credible industry expert
  • Experience supporting Fortune 500 clients through long-term engagements
  • A passion for leading teams, mentoring talent, and building inclusive, high-performing cultures
  • Exceptional consulting skills across communication, analytics, leadership presence, and problem solving
  • Willingness to travel as required (with frequent presence in New York strongly preferred)
